What is arifosmcp?
arifosmcp is the implementation of the arifOS constitutional intelligence kernel — the actual code that enforces the 13 Floors, runs the 000-999 pipeline, and delivers the 11 mega-tools.

🔧 TROUBLESHOOTING
Issue: "Module file points to site-packages"
Symptom: import arifosmcp loads /usr/local/lib/python3.12/site-packages/
Cause: pip install in Dockerfile creates conflicting package
Fix: Rebuild image or ensure volume mounts are correct
Issue: "philosophy returns null"
Symptom: init_anchor returns null philosophy
Cause: Old site-packages version loaded
Fix: Rebuild container, clear Python cache
Issue: "OLLAMA connection failed"
Symptom: agi_mind returns connection error
Fix: docker compose restart ollama && docker compose logs --tail=20 ollama
